top of page

Creepos Tales 2
Redwood National Park closes its gates every Friday the 13th. According to legend, Mason, a ranger who used to work for the park and mysteriously disappeared, is haunting the park every Friday the 13th. Will you dare join Pedro behind the park's closed gates?
More Galleries You May Like
bottom of page